About Skype on XFINITY
Skype on XFINITY delivers high-quality, face-to-face video calling right to your TV. Enjoy video and audio
calls—even messages—without a computer, without opening a browser. It’s the next best
thing to being there.
• ConnectwithXFINITYandSkypecontacts,withHDvideo/audiocallsandmessages.Nowyouwill
never have to miss an important moment.
• Oncesignedin,youcanmakeorreceivecallsandmessageswhilewatchingTV.Forincomingcalls,
you will see who is calling you and be able to choose how you want to connect—by video or audio.
Important Notes
• TheEmergencyAlertSystem(EAS)fornationalpublicwarningsonlybroadcastsinTVmode(not
duringcallsormessaging).LearnmoreaboutEASatwww.fcc.gov/pshs/services/eas.
• NoemergencycallswithSkype.Skypeisnotareplacementforyourtelephoneandcan’tbeusedfor
emergency calling.
• DatausedwhileenjoyingSkypeonXFINITYcountstowardyourComcastmonthly
Internet bandwidth usage. For more information go to www.comcast.com/corporate/customers/
policies/highspeedinternetaup.html.

Adaptor Box
• HDMIConnectionsBetweenSet-TopBoxandTV
• Dual-band(2.4GHz/5GHz)WirelessNetwork(802.11n)
• Ethernet-ReadyforWiredConnection
• DigitalAudioOutput
• AudibleNotications
• IntegrationwithSkype
• WPS-CapableforWirelessSetup(currentlynotavailable)
• NewMessageIndicator(currentlynotavailable)
• SDSlotforViewingMedia(currentlynotavailable)
Helpful Hints for the Adaptor Box
• ThereisnoOn/Offindicatorlight.ThePowerLEDremainslitwhenpluggedin.
• Pleasebeawarethatdigitalaudiocanrunthroughyourdigitalaudioreceiver,butdigitalvideo
mustbeconnecteddirectlyfromyouradaptorboxtoyourTV.
• TheResetbuttonisrecessedtopreventaccidentalpressingandhastwofunctions,depending
onthelengthoftimeheld:
- NormalReset:InsertathinobjectandholdtheResetbuttonfor2-5 secondstorebootthe
adaptorboxandkeepyourpersonalsettings.
FactoryReset:InsertathinobjectandholdtheResetbuttonfor15 or more secondsto
deleteALLpersonalsettingsandrestoretheadaptorboxtothedefaultfactorysettings.Factory
Resetshouldbeusedwithcaution,asitremovesallSkypeonXFINITYproles.

Camera Setup
TheXFINITY cameracanbeplacedontopofyourTVscreenoronaatsurface(likeaTVconsole).The
recommendedviewingdistanceis5’-12’.Thecamerashouldnotbeusednearstrongmagneticelds
(see illustration on next page).
TV Top
1.PlacethefrontofthecameraontopofyourTV,withthebottomliprestingjustbelow
thetopofthescreen.
2.PushtheclipdownuntilittouchesthebackoftheTVandthecameraissecure.
3.Adjusttheangleofthecameratocaptureyourpreferredviewingareaandtoensurethatthe
microphonesaredirectlyinfrontofthepersonspeaking.
Flat Surface
1.Holdthecamerawiththelensfacingtowardsyouandadjusttheclip’srubberbottom,asshown.
2.Placethecameraonaatsurfacewiththelensfacingtheviewingarea.Holdtherubberbottomin
placewhileadjustingtheangleofthecameratocaptureyourpreferredviewingareaandtoensurethat
themicrophonesaredirectlyinfrontofthepersonspeaking.
Important Note for Wall-Mounted TVs
Makesurethecombinedweightofthecamera(8.81oz.)andTVdoesnotexceedthemaximum
ratingforyourwallmount.Checkthewallmountmanufacturer’smanualforthemaximumrating.The
cameraclipisnotcompatiblewithallTVwallmounts.Forwall-mountedTVsthathavebeeninstalled
ushwiththewall,cameraplacementonyourTVisnotrecommendedduetospaceconstraints,
whichmayresultindamagetoyourTVorthecamera.
Important Note for Fireplace-Mounted TVs
Thecameraisnotintendedforuseinhigh-temperaturelocations,suchasabovereplaces.
Helpful Hints for Setup
• Thecamera’sbroadanglewillgiveyoutheabilitytorelaxacrosstheroomwhileenjoyinga
conversation.RuntheCameraTest(duringtheTVactivationorgotoSettings > System Settings >
Video Settingsatanytime)toseewhatareawillbecapturedduringavideocall.
• Positiontable/standinglampsinfrontofyoutoavoidappearingsilhouetted.
• Turndownoverheadlightsandpositionasecondarytableorstandinglampinfrontofyouto
avoidhavingtoturnoverheadlightsallthewayup.
•IfthecameracableisnotlongenoughtoreachtheCamera p o r t , c o n n e c t t h e U S B e x t e n s i o n
cabletothecameracable.

Connect
Thefollowingillustrationshowstwopotentialset-ups.Thesetupontheleftiswithoutareceiver,DVDplayeror
gameconsole.Thesetupontherightincludesareceiver,DVDplayerandgameconsole.

16 Setup
Thestepsbelowmaydifferslightlydependingonyourmediasetup,buttheequipmentordershould
remainthesame(see the illustration on following page).
A.PlugintheprovidedHDMIcabletoyourset-topboxandtheotherendtotheHDMI Cable Inporton
youradaptorbox.
B.PlugasecondHDMIcabletotheHDMI TV Out portonyouradaptorboxandtheotherendtooneof
theavailableHDMIportsonyourTV.
•Note:Ifyouhaveanaudioreceiver,useoneHDMIcabletoconnectyourset-topboxtoyourreceiver
thenuseanotherHDMIcabletoconnectthereceivertoyouradapterbox(see the illustration on
following page).
C.PlugthecameracableintotheCameraport.Ifthecameracableisnotlongenoughtoreachthe
Cameraport,connecttheUSBextensioncabletothecameracable.
D.DecideifyouwanttoconnecttoyourhomenetworkusingawiredEthernetcableor
wirelessconnection.
• Ethernetconnection:PlugaCAT-6Ethernetcable(notprovided)totheEthernetportonyour
adaptorboxandtheotherendtoanavailableportonyourmodemorrouter.
• Wirelessconnection:SkipthisstepandfollowtheinstructionswhenyouactivateonyourTV.
E.IfyouareusinganaudioreceiverwithanSPDIF(OpticalDigitalAudio)cable,disconnectthiscable
fromyourset-topboxandplugitintotheAudioportontheadaptorbox.SinceSPDIFonlytransmits
audio,youwillalsohavetoconnectviaHDMIinordertoseeanyvideo.Westronglyrecommendusing
bothHDMIandSPDIFcables(as depicted in the illustration) toconnectyouradaptorbox.
F. Connectthepoweradaptortothepoweradaptorcable(see the illustration on following page).
G.UsingyourTVremote,selectthesameHDMIinputtowhichyouconnectedtheadaptorbox.

Power Up
Ifyouneedhelpwithsetup,visithttp://comcast.com/skypeorcallat877-704-7713.
1. PlugthepowercableintothePowerportontheadaptorcable.Thenplugthepowercableinto
anelectricaloutlet.Thereisnopowerbuttononyouradaptorbox,sothispowercableistheonly
waytoturnthesystemonandoff.
2. TurnonyourTV,set-topboxandaudioreceiver(ifyouhaveone).
3.MakesurethatyourTVissettotheHDMIportthatyouconnectedtheHDMIcableto.For
example,ifyoupluggedthecableintoHDMI1,thenmakesurethatyourTVissettoHDMI1(not
HDMI2,HDMI3,etc.).
4. Nextyouwillseeablackscreen.
5.In a few minutes (up to 20), you will be greeted with a Welcome screen.
Important Note for Power Up
Pleasedonotunplugorresettheadaptorboxbeforeyouseethisscreen.Ifyouunplugorresetthe
adaptorboxbeforeactivationiscomplete,thesystemwillrestartfromthebeginningofthe
setupprocess.
Helpful Hints for Powering Up
• Thepoweradaptorismadeupoftwopiecesthatjointogether.
• Ifneeded,usetheUSBextensioncabletoaddlengthtoyourcameracable.

Pair Your Remote
The pairing process connects your remote to the adaptor box so that the adaptor box—and Skype on
XFINITY—can only be controlled by one remote.
1. Pull out the tab from the remote’s battery compartment.
2. Press and hold the Setup button on your remote until the red light on your remote turns green.
3. Press the Call button on your remote.
4. Flip the remote to the keyboard side.
5. Use the keyboard to enter the 3 letters displayed on your TV screen. Note: The letters on your
screen may differ from the example shown here.
Helpful Hints for Remote Pairing
• Youonlyhave60secondstopressthelettersonyourremotethatcorrespondtolettersonyour
screen.Ifyoudonotnishthiswithin60seconds,simplyrestarttheprocess.
• Ifyourremoteisnotworking,refertotheHelpful Hints for the Remote section on page 9.
• Ifyouenteranincorrectletterduringthepairingprocess,thescreenwillrefreshandyouwillbe
asked to retry.
